Bespoke boosts envelope output

Envelope manufacturer Bespoke Envelopes Direct has added an extra 55,000 envelopes per hour capacity with the purchase of two machines from US firm Halm worth 300,000.

The first machine, a Halm EM5000 (pictured), prints four colours on the front of the envelope and one colour on the reverse. Production speed is 30,000 envelopes per hour. The second is a two-colour Halm Jet XL, which is capable of 25,000 envelopes per hour.

Nigel Harper, managing director at Bespoke, said: “We have a tremendous range of printing and manufacturing equipment and will continue to invest in the very latest machinery to ensure that we are as productive as possible.”
